Hawk Stratos Stradale

In Red with black Vitaloni California mirrors, black roof and tail spoiler.

11 months Tax and MoT

Hawk 5 stud 98 PCD hub conversion with Alfa 164 brakes
Hawk Campagnolo Coffin Spoke Alloys / Campagnolo centre caps with new Toyo Proxes all round 225/50/15 rears and 205/50/15 fronts.

Alfa V6 3000 12v power with standard gearbox.
Both heads fully rebuilt and re-shimmed, new cam belt fitted.
Hawk Stainless Steel V6 Exhaust
Cone Air filter
Samco hoses
Adjustable front suspension
Leda adjustable rear suspension

Hawk seats seats and door cards professionally trimmed in Dec 06 in Black Alcantara with red stitching.
Sparco steering wheel
Wooden gear knob
Veglia dials
Interior courtesy in foot wells

Original Carrello fog lights
Fulvia style front indicator lenses
Age related number plate (from 1976)
Windscreen recently refitted / sealed / polished.

Everything electrical works (modified headlights so they rise / fall properly).

This is a genuine replica, which I think has been tastefully done.
